How Under Sink Water Filter Systems Work

People install under sink water filters under the kitchen sink to filter drinking and cooking water. These systems typically include multiple stages of filtration, each designed to remove specific contaminants. Key components may include:

1. Sediment Filters: Remove larger particles like sand, dirt, and rust.

2. Carbon Filters: Absorb organic compounds, chlorine, and other chemicals, improving taste and odor.

4. Reverse Osmosis (RO) Filters: Use a membrane to filter water and remove contaminants.

Choosing the Right Water Filter for Legionella Virus

When selecting an under sink water filter system to protect against the Legionella virus, consider the following features:

1. Multiple Filtration Stages: Look for systems that combine sediment, carbon, UV, and RO filters for comprehensive protection.

2. Certification: Ensure the system is certified by reputable organizations, such as NSF International, for pathogen removal.

3. Maintenance: Choose systems with simple filter replacement and low maintenance needs.

4. Flow Rate: Consider the flow rate to ensure adequate water supply for your household needs.

Installation and Maintenance

To install an under sink water filter, connect it to your plumbing. Some systems have DIY instructions, but pro installation is best. Regular maintenance, like changing filters on time, keeps the system working well.
